Skip to content

Commit 54d242a

Browse files
committed
fixed keycloak principal to ds user conversion
1 parent 0f0389b commit 54d242a

1 file changed

Lines changed: 2 additions & 2 deletions

File tree

src/main/java/com/digitalsanctuary/spring/user/service/DSOAuth2UserService.java

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-158,8 +158,8 @@ public User getUserFromKeycloakOAuth2User(OAuth2User principal) {
158158
log.debug("Principal attributes: {}", principal.getAttributes());
159159
User user = new User();
160160
user.setEmail(principal.getAttribute("email"));
161-
user.setFirstName(principal.getAttribute("firstName"));
162-
user.setLastName(principal.getAttribute("lastName"));
161+
user.setFirstName(principal.getAttribute("given_name"));
162+
user.setLastName(principal.getAttribute("family_name"));
163163
user.setProvider(User.Provider.KEYCLOAK);
164164
return user;
165165
}

0 commit comments

Comments
 (0)